Prepare
Charge power
Charge through the AC adaptor
Caution
Risk of product damage. Ensure that the power supply voltage corresponds to the voltage printed
on the bottom of the player.
Use only the supplied adaptors to charge the battery.
Note
The type plate is located on the bottom of the player.
To fast charge the battery,
1 press to switch off the player.
background
13EN
2 Connect the supplied AC adaptor to the player and to the AC outlet.
» The CHR indicator turns on (red).
» When the battery is fully charged, the CHR indicator turns off.
Tip
You can also charge the battery during play.
To maximize battery life, recharge the battery immediately once the battery is fully discharged. If
you do not use the player for a long time, recharge the battery once every two months.

Select OSD language
You can choose a different language for the on-screen display text.
1 Press SETUP.
» The setup menu is displayed.
2 Go to [General] > [Language].
3 Press / to select a language option.
4 Press /OKWRFRQÀUP
5 Press SETUP to exit.

7 Troubleshooting
Warning
Risk of electric shock. Never remove the casing of the player.
To keep the warranty valid, never try to repair the system yourself.
If you encounter problems when using the player, check the following points
before requesting service. If the problem remains unsolved, register your player
and get support at www.philips.com/support. When you contact Philips, ensure
that your apparatus is nearby and the model number and serial number are
available.
No power
Ensure that both plugs of the mains cord are properly connected.
Ensure that there is power at the AC outlet.
Check if the built-in battery is drained.
No sound
 (QVXUHWKDWWKH$9FDEOHLVFRQQHFWHGFRUUHFWO\
Distorted picture
Clean the disc. With a clean, soft, lint-free cloth, wipe the disc outwards from
the center.
0DNHVXUHWKDWWKHYLGHRRXWSXWIRUPDWRIWKHGLVFLVFRPSDWLEOHZLWKWKH79
&KDQJHWKHYLGHRRXWSXWIRUPDWWRPDWFK\RXU79RUSURJUDP
The LCD is manufactured using high precision technology. You may, however,
see tiny black points and/or bright points(red, blue, green) that continuously
appear on the LCD. This is a normal result of the manufacturing process and
does not indicate a malfunction.
Cannot play disc
Ensure the disc label is upwards.
Clean the disc. With a clean, soft, lint-free cloth, wipe the disc outwards from
the center.
Check if the disc is defective by trying another disc.
